Taylor Swift: An Artist Shaping Music History
Taylor Swift first emerged on the music scene as a country singer-songwriter, gaining fame with her self-titled debut album in 2006. However, as she transitioned through genres, her storytelling capabilities deepened, resonating with a diverse fan base. From her country roots to pop anthems, and indie folk sounds, Swift has mastered the art of reinvention. Her collaborations with various artists have further broadened her appeal, manifesting in her ability to craft songs that touch upon universal themes like love, heartbreak, and personal growth. With The Tortured Poets Department, she is set to add another chapter to her already illustrious career, signaling not just growth, but also a return to personal, raw songwriting. Each album she releases is an exploration of where she has been and where she intends to go, making her discography a critical study in modern music.
The Significance of The Tortured Poets Department (Ghosted White Vinyl)
The Tortured Poets Department is more than a collection of songs; it represents a significant point of reflection in Swift’s career. The album was developed during her Eras Tour, which has become a cultural event in its own right, further connecting her to her fanbase. This double LP set on white colored vinyl is a striking addition to any collector’s library, adding a visual appeal that parallels the album’s artistic ambitions. Notably, it features a bonus track, “The Manuscript,” unique to this pressing, making it more appealing to those seeking exclusive content. The album boasts sixteen tracks, including collaborations with Post Malone on “Fortnight” and Florence and the Machine on “Florida!!!.” Such partnerships demonstrate Swift’s willingness to experiment while maintaining her distinct sound.
